Limitation of time for statutes

When filing a suit for an accident in the car it is important to be aware of the time limit. The victim might not be entitled to compensation if they fail to file their claim within the specified time. There are ways to extend the deadline. A qualified attorney can apply for an exception to the statute of limitations.

Personal injury and wrongful deaths claims are subject to the statute of limitations. These types of claims have a distinct filing timeframe based on state. In general, the filing window for personal injury lawsuits is three years following the date of the accident. In certain states however, these deadlines can be extended. If someone is suffering from an illness of the mind, they may be eligible to file a lawsuit, provided they have regained some of their mental faculties.

Costs

An attorney in car accidents is required to represent you if you've been in an accident and want compensation. They work with other professionals to determine the severity of the accident and the amount of compensation you should receive. This includes medical expenses, hospital stays as well as physical therapy and psychotherapy, medications tests, and home modifications. They can also negotiate with your medical professionals to lower the cost of your treatment.

Many car accident lawyers are based on contingency fees. In this arrangement, the lawyer does not charge you until he/she she wins a settlement for you. In return the lawyer will be paid an amount of the settlement. The lawyer could earn $33,000 if you win the $100,000 settlement. It is crucial to know the terms of payment and insist on a written contract.

Some lawyers in car accidents charge by the hour. They keep track of the time they've spent on your case. It is important to determine an hourly fee when choosing a car wreck lawyer. If you only require the attorney for a short time, a lesser hourly rate could be more affordable.

Ethics

When choosing an attorney who can help you in your car accident, it is important to evaluate the ethics of the attorney. There have been many instances of unethical behavior from lawyers, such as paying tow truck companies for transporting drivers to the scene of an accident or paying runners lawyers to visit hospitals. These practices are against the law and can cause insurance fraud. In fact two years ago, the Texas legislature approved House Bill 148, which restricts car accident lawyers from soliciting victims for compensation within the first 30 days after an accident.

While some attorneys disregard ethical standards The majority of reputable attorneys are content to wait for their clients to approach them. They're not trying fool clients. They simply seek compensation for their losses. This belief is based on the fact that lawyers are bound by rules set by the American Bar Association. In case of violation of these regulations attorneys can lose his or her license, and so it is essential to ensure that you select an attorney you can trust.
